Elmhurst Ballet School Collaboration

while at university, I had the fantastic opportunity to collaborate with Elmhurst Ballet School to create costumes for their graduate class performance of À La Mode. These shows were performed at the Shaw Theatre in London, and at Elmhurst School.

The costumes are based on Shakespeare plays, mine being influenced by Richard III. We had to design conceptual dance costumes by bringing the plays historical themes into a modern, contemporary setting. The costumes combine creative cutting and zero waste pattern cutting techniques to bring a more sustainable conscious approach to creating a costume.
